Now I'm off topic. Ok. The delegate and the thing with the delegate method have a relationship. For example, say we have three things, a house with a fancy number pad door, an atm, and a calculator.  All of these things share something in common: a number pad thing. That number pad thing is NOT the delegate. It is the one getting the messages and the numbers and the fun. The house and atm and calculator just need to know what keys are pressed when they're pressed. The number pad has a method that says what key is pressed.

so if the number pad thing isn't the delegate, what is? In this example, the house, atm, and calculator can become the delegate. That's right people! something can have multiple delegates!

In the process of writing this, I've confused myself. So let me set myself straight. The thing with the delegate method in it doesn't have a name because it can be anything. It can be a dog, or a view controller, or a piano. The delegate is what needs to know the info that the dog or view controller or piano know. Here are the points that you should remember.
1. The language of delegation is hard. This is because anything can have a delegate method and anything can be a delegate.
2. Delegation is a connection between these two things. The thing with the delegate method gets a message and then sends it to the delegate. This message can be as simple as BUTTON WAS PRESSED! or as complicated as a complicated thing.
3. Setting the delegate (another confusing word thing with delegation) is essentially just telling the connection what it's between. So you tell the starting point that they are the delegate and the ending point that they are the delegate.

The metaphor that made sense? Delegation is a tunnel. Setting the delegate is just telling different things where the tunnel entrance and exit are. Then they can send things through the tunnel.
